alzheimers changed my perspective on life with alyssa malette

Alyssa Malette, daughter of Vince Malette, who was diagnosed with early onset Alzheimer’s at the age of 52, joins me on the podcast today. Vince is a retired DEL + OHL coach. Alyssa is incredibly strong for sharing her vulnerable story on BTI and I was so inspired by her story + her strength. You can feel the bond that Alyssa and her dad have together.

In this episode we talk about

-Alzheimers and what this disease is

-How she could see changes within her dad by watching him on the bench 

-The hardest part about the diagnosis for her and her family

-She shares about how important it is to not take life for granted, tell your loved ones that you love them and enjoy every moment.
